Epson's new lightweight EMP-735 multimedia, ultra-portable wireless projector

March 2003


Sydney 4th March 2003: Epson, the world leader in colour image management, today released the new lightweight EMP-735 multimedia, ultra-portable wireless projector.

Epson's all new EMP-735 wireless projector packs a punch with maximum features, true wireless flexibility and a weight under 2kgs, to be the best value projector on the market - with the best feature set.

At 1.9kg, the EMP-735 stands out in the wireless projector market. But the features don't stop there. Epson have packed the EMP-735 with features you'd expect from a large footprint semi-portable projector with a much larger price tag.

"The EMP-730 is our best selling corporate portable projector, and we've taken the same footprint and added complete wireless and PC-free functionality to the EMP-735", said Bruce Bealby, Projector Business Marketing Manager, Epson Australia.

"The wireless technology built into the EMP-735 is unique to Epson. One of the biggest problems with wireless projectors has been the time lag when presenting. The EMP-735 gets around this by using Epson's client software to speed up the communication between the projector and the PC/Laptop. The results are astounding. Slide to slide movement is nearly instantaneous, and the clarity and colour depth of the EMP-735 are second to none."

The EMP-735 ships with an Epson PCMCIA wireless network card. Users have the option of connecting their computer to the projector via standard 802.11b (WiFi) network. Up to four EMP-735 projectors can be driven by one computer - making the EMP-735 ideal for large conference venues, where more than one projector is required to display the same presentation.

The EMP-735 also supports multiple computer access to the one projector, so that presenter changes are simple and seamless. One presentation ends and the next begins - no need to unplug cables and crawl around under desks or across boardroom tables, simply select the EMP-735's I.P address using the provided PC client software and take control.

Alternatively the user can simply dump their presentation onto a flash or Memorystick™ equipped, type 2.1 PCMCIA card and run the presentation without a PC, making it ideal for road warriors. No need to lug a projector and a laptop from office to office. Simply plug in the power, point the 1.9kg EMP-735 at a wall, and away you go.

The type II slot and Epson's "EasyMP" software also allow the projector to be used as a slide projector as well. Download photos directly from your Digital Still Camera onto a flash card, insert the flash card into your PCMCIA card and slide it into the slot on the EMP-735. Epson's "EasyMP" software is then booted using the wireless remote control and you can view your photos on the projector screen.

EasyMP also allows the user to modify the PowerPoint presentation directly from the flash card, without a computer. Simply access the menu using the projector remote, select the EasyMP software and you can perform PowerPoint functions like moving or deleting slides, or changing slide transitions.

The EMP-735 continues the tradition of the EMP-730. Not only is it STILL the lightest, brightest, feature rich projector on the Australian market, but now it leads in the wireless category as well.

Features include digital zoom, 2000 ANSI Lumens output, on screen menus for optical focus and all the normal I/O ports you would expect from the market's leading projector, make the Epson EMP-735 a welterweight winner in a market filled with heavyweights.
